Polestar Cyan Racing hits WTCC half-time in Russia this weekend

 

Polestar Cyan Racing is heading to Moscow Raceway for the sixth FIA World Touring Car Championship race of 2016 this weekend, meaning half of the races done, following a promising weekend in Germany two weeks ago where Thed Björk challenged for a podium finish.

 

Five fast facts

  • Moscow Raceway was opened in 2012

  • WTCC has raced at Moscow Raceway since 2013

  • Polestar Cyan Racing has topped all speed traps so far this season

  • Moscow Raceway is designed by renowned F1 circuit architect Hermann Tilke

  • Polestar Cyan Racing has never before raced in Russia

 

Björk started third for the first race in Germany at the legendary Nürburgring Nordschleife and had caught the race leader after the first 25 kilometre lap when a technical issue unfortunately put his race to an end.

  

”We showed that we have pace to challenge for the top and to show that this early in the season is very rewarding. Our journey continues this weekend on Moscow Raceway where I have never been before but I am very much looking forward to it to continue moving forward,” said Thed Björk.

  

Team mate Fredrik Ekblom scored world championship points in both races in Germany and has so far finished in the points in seven out of ten races.

  

”I am never pleased until I am on top of the podium. But the main thing so far is that we have been in the points in the majority of the races, promising for a strong second half of our first WTCC season,” said Fredrik Ekblom.

  

Polestar Cyan Racing has so far completed ten race heats and most importantly gathered vast amounts of data.

  

”We have reached a level where we begin to understand the car, something that gives our team and drivers confidence to push for race results. Yet we are continuously heading for new tracks where we have no data. Confidence is good, but it is also a challenge to remain realistic and don't forget the importance this year’s data collection has in the long term,” said Alexander Murdzevski Schedvin, Head of Motorsport at Polestar.

  

The WTCC weekend in Moscow starts with testing on Friday, practice and qualifying on Saturday and two races on Sunday, both broadcasted live on Eurosport. Follow the team live during the weekend through: http://wtcc.polestar.com

About Polestar

Polestar is the performance brand of Volvo Cars. The company was founded as a motorsport team in 1996 and has been successful in numerous championships, racing with various Volvo models. In 2009, Polestar started to offer performance related products and thereby intensified the business relations with Volvo Cars. The first performance cars, based on Volvo’s S60 and V60, were launched in 2014. In 2015, Volvo Cars acquired the performance unit of Polestar, as a strong commitment towards a credible performance offer and with the mission to define future premium performance.

 

About Cyan Racing

Cyan Racing is the motorsport partner to Polestar. The company is owned by Christian Dahl and handles all motorsport operations of Polestar. Cyan Racing, formerly named Polestar Racing, has claimed five STCC drivers’ titles and seven STCC teams’ titles with the Volvo 850, S40, C30 and S60.

Volvo Car Group in 2015

Voor het boekjaar 2015 liet Volvo Car Group (Volvo Cars) een bedrijfswinst optekenen van SEK 6.620 miljoen (EUR 706 miljoen), tegenover SEK 2.128 miljoen (EUR 229 miljoen) in 2014. De omzet voor dit boekjaar bedroeg SEK 164.043 miljoen (EUR 17,5 miljard), tegenover SEK 137.590 miljoen (EUR 14,7 miljard) in 2014. In 2015 verkocht Volvo Car Group wereldwijd 503.127 auto's, ofwel 8% meer dan in 2014. Deze recordcijfers qua omzet en bedrijfswinst betekenen dat Volvo Car Group kan blijven investeren in het wereldwijde transformatieplan.

 

Over Volvo Car Group

Volvo is actief sinds 1927. Vandaag is Volvo Cars een van de bekendste en meest gerespecteerde automerken ter wereld. In 2015 werden 503 127  Volvo's verkocht in ongeveer 100 landen. Sinds 2010 is Volvo Cars eigendom van Zhejiang Geely Holding (Geely Holding) uit China. Het bedrijf maakte deel uit van de Zweeds Volvo Group tot 1999, wanneer het werd gekocht door het Amerikaanse Ford Motor Company. In 2010 werd Volvo Cars uiteindelijk overgenomen door Geely Holding.  

In december 2015 stelde Volvo Cars wereldwijd meer dan 29.000 medewerkers tewerk. De hoofdzetel, productontwikkeling, marketing en administratie van Volvo Cars zijn grotendeels gevestigd in Göteborg, Zweden. Het hoofdkantoor van Volvo Cars voor China is gevestigd in Shanghai. De grootste autofabrieken van het bedrijf zijn gevestigd in Göteborg (Zweden), Gent (België) en Chengdu (China), terwijl de motoren worden gemaakt in Skövde (Zweden) en Zhangjiakou (China) en de carrosserie-onderdelen in Olofström (Zweden).
